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 DEF
A hypabyssal rock, granitic in composition, having a porphyritic, microgranular texture. 2, record 1, English, - microgranite
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 OBS
Microgranites are merely very fine grained types. 3, record 1, English, - microgranite
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 2 OBS
Microgranites and granophyres differ little from granites except in coarseness and texture. 4, record 1, English, - microgranite
